‘BMW S 1000 RR Pro’ Variants and Specifications

The BMW S 1000 RR Pro represents a top-tier variant of the legendary S 1000 RR series. It is equipped with a high-performance 999 cc, liquid-cooled, 4-stroke in-line four-cylinder engine. This potent motor is engineered to deliver exceptional power and torque, typically producing around 209 PS and 113 Nm of peak torque. This immense power is managed by a precise 6-speed constant mesh gearbox, enhanced with BMW's Shift Assistant Pro for seamless, clutchless up and downshifts. While mileage is not its primary focus, riders can expect approximately 15-18 kmpl under varied riding conditions. The S 1000 RR Pro's specifications underline its pure, unadulterated performance credentials, making it a formidable machine on the road and track.

Features and Technology

The BMW S 1000 RR Pro is packed with cutting-edge features and technology designed to enhance both safety and performance. Key safety systems include sophisticated ABS Pro, offering optimal braking even in corners, and Dynamic Traction Control (DTC) for superior grip. Multiple riding modes (Rain, Road, Dynamic, Race, and customizable Pro modes) allow riders to tailor the bike's characteristics. Dynamic Damping Control (DDC) provides electronic suspension adjustment for optimal handling. For convenience, it features a full-color 6.5-inch TFT display, offering comprehensive ride information and connectivity. Build quality is exemplary, utilizing lightweight materials and precision engineering. The ergonomic design, while track-focused, ensures excellent control and a remarkably engaging ride experience, supported by premium components throughout.

Mileage, Performance, and Riding Experience

While mileage is secondary for a superbike, the BMW S 1000 RR Pro typically delivers around 15-18 kmpl in real-world conditions. Its performance is nothing short of electrifying. The S 1000 RR Pro offers blistering acceleration and incredible top speeds, making it a dominant force on the track. On highways, its powerful engine and stable chassis ensure a thrilling and confident ride. However, for city use, its aggressive ergonomics and powerful engine can be demanding, especially in heavy traffic. Navigating Indian road conditions requires skill due to its firm suspension setup and lower ground clearance compared to commuter bikes. The overall riding experience is intense, rewarding experienced riders with unparalleled precision, feedback, and raw power.

Competitors of ‘BMW S 1000 RR Pro’ in India

The BMW S 1000 RR Pro faces stiff competition in the elite superbike segment in India. Its primary rivals include the Kawasaki Ninja ZX-10R, the Ducati Panigale V4, and the Honda CBR1000RR-R Fireblade. These competitors all offer similar levels of high performance, advanced electronics, and premium build quality. Competition is fierce, often coming down to brand loyalty, specific rider aid preferences, and subtle differences in handling characteristics and engine delivery. Each model aims to deliver the ultimate track and road experience, making the superbike segment a battleground of cutting-edge technology and engineering prowess.
